Output 39a426fba1e7993c308bafd0e6dbcd3491e169682cbb3de58b4132ab2c6153d5:1

value
14827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98395871cfa3eebb64d976bdeb368cc4f7512ec7 OP_EQUALVERIFY OP_CHECKSIG
address
1EstQbN87gMRdjejktpLLWQkS9aXUrBeFB
transaction
39a426fba1e7993c308bafd0e6dbcd3491e169682cbb3de58b4132ab2c6153d5
confirmations
424724
spent
true